We synthesized a series of bis(10-phenylanthracen-9-yl) derivatives containing various heterocyclic moieties such as 9-ethylcarbazole, dibenzofuran and dibenzothiophene (1-3),by Suzuki cross-coupling reactions. To explore electroluminescent properties of these materials, multilayered devices were fabricated with configuration of indium-tin-oxide (ITO) (180 nm)/4,4'-bis(N-(1-naphthyl)-N-phenylamino)biphenyl (NPB) (50 nm)/Emitters 1-3 (30 nm)/Tris(8-hydroxyquinolinato) aluminium (Alq(3)) (15 nm)/lithium quinolate (Liq) (2.0 nm)/Al (100 nm). In particular, a device using 2,8-bis(10-phenylanthracen-9-yl)dibenzo[b,d]furan (2), as an emitter, exhibited efficient blue emission with maximum luminance, luminous, power and external quantum efficiency of 620 cd/m(2), 2.05 cd/A, 1.05 lm/W, 1.43% at 20 mA/cm(2), and CIE coordinates of (x = 0.18, y = 0.17) at 8 V, respectively.
